Hosea 5
-
1“Listen to this, you priests!
- Listen, house of Israel,
- and give ear, house of the king!
- For the judgment is against you;
- for you have been a snare at Mizpah,
- and a net spread on Tabor.
-
2The rebels are deep in slaughter;
- but I discipline all of them.
-
3I know Ephraim,
- and Israel is not hidden from me;
- for now, Ephraim, you have played the prostitute.
- Israel is defiled.
-
4Their deeds won’t allow them to turn to their God;
- for the spirit of prostitution is within them,
- and they don’t know Yahweh.
-
5The pride of Israel testifies to his face.
- Therefore Israel and Ephraim will stumble in their iniquity.
- Judah also will stumble with them.
-
6They will go with their flocks and with their herds to seek Yahweh;
- but they won’t find him.
- He has withdrawn himself from them.
-
7They are unfaithful to Yahweh;
- for they have borne illegitimate children.
- Now the new moon will devour them with their fields.
-
8“Blow the cornet in Gibeah,
- and the trumpet in Ramah!
- Sound a battle cry at Beth Aven, behind you, Benjamin!
-
9Ephraim will become a desolation in the day of rebuke.
- Among the tribes of Israel, I have made known that which will surely be.
-
10The princes of Judah are like those who remove a landmark.
- I will pour out my wrath on them like water.
-
11Ephraim is oppressed,
- he is crushed in judgment;
- Because he is intent in his pursuit of idols.
-
12Therefore I am to Ephraim like a moth,
- and to the house of Judah like rottenness.
-
13“When Ephraim saw his sickness,
- and Judah his wound,
- Then Ephraim went to Assyria,
- and sent to king Jareb:
- but he is not able to heal you,
- neither will he cure you of your wound.
-
14For I will be to Ephraim like a lion,
- and like a young lion to the house of Judah.
- I myself will tear in pieces and go away.
- I will carry off, and there will be no one to deliver.
-
15I will go and return to my place,
- until they acknowledge their offense,
- and seek my face.
- In their affliction they will seek me earnestly.”
